AI‘s Perspective: English Composition Strategies and the Future of Language Learning110


Artificial intelligence is rapidly transforming various aspects of our lives, and the field of education is no exception. This essay will explore the unique perspective an AI might offer on English composition, considering its capabilities in analyzing language patterns, identifying errors, and generating text. We will also examine how AI is changing the landscape of language learning and the potential implications for the future.

From an AI's perspective, English composition is essentially a complex data processing problem. We analyze vast datasets of written English, identifying recurring patterns, grammatical structures, and stylistic choices. This allows us to understand the nuances of language, recognizing not only the correctness of grammar and spelling but also the effectiveness of communication. For example, we can identify clichés, assess the clarity and conciseness of writing, and even detect the emotional tone conveyed through word choice and sentence structure. This analytical capability is far beyond the scope of a typical human grader, allowing for a more comprehensive and nuanced evaluation of a student's writing.

One crucial aspect of AI's contribution to English composition is error detection and correction. We can pinpoint grammatical errors, spelling mistakes, and punctuation issues with remarkable accuracy. Furthermore, we can provide detailed explanations for each correction, helping students understand the underlying grammatical rules and improve their writing skills. This feedback is often more immediate and targeted than human feedback, facilitating a more efficient learning process. We can also suggest improvements in style, word choice, and sentence structure, enhancing the overall quality and impact of the writing.

Beyond error correction, AI can assist students in the creative process of writing. We can provide suggestions for topic generation, brainstorming ideas, and outlining essays. We can even generate text based on given prompts or outlines, serving as a tool for overcoming writer's block and exploring different writing styles. However, it’s crucial to emphasize that AI should be used as a tool to assist, not replace, human creativity and critical thinking. The generated text should be seen as a starting point for refinement and development by the student.

The impact of AI on English composition extends beyond individual learners. It is transforming the way teachers assess and provide feedback on student writing. AI-powered tools can automate the grading process, freeing up teachers to focus on providing more personalized instruction and mentoring. They can also provide valuable insights into student learning patterns, identifying areas where students struggle and adapting their teaching strategies accordingly. This efficient feedback loop allows for a more dynamic and responsive learning environment.

Looking towards the future, AI's role in English composition is likely to become even more significant. We anticipate further advancements in natural language processing (NLP) will lead to more sophisticated AI writing assistants that can provide even more nuanced and personalized feedback. These assistants could adapt to individual learning styles, providing targeted support based on a student's strengths and weaknesses. They might even be able to predict potential errors before they are made, proactively guiding students towards clearer and more effective writing.

However, the increasing reliance on AI in English composition also raises important ethical considerations. Concerns about plagiarism and the potential for students to over-rely on AI-generated text need to be addressed. It is crucial to emphasize the importance of academic integrity and the development of critical thinking skills, ensuring that AI is used responsibly and ethically as a tool to enhance, not replace, human learning and creativity.

Furthermore, the accessibility of AI tools for English composition also needs careful consideration. The digital divide could exacerbate existing inequalities in education, with students from disadvantaged backgrounds potentially lacking access to these valuable resources. Efforts must be made to ensure equitable access to AI-powered tools to foster inclusive and equitable learning opportunities for all students.

In conclusion, from an AI perspective, English composition presents a fascinating challenge in natural language processing and machine learning. Our ability to analyze, evaluate, and even generate text offers significant opportunities for enhancing language learning and improving the quality of student writing. However, the ethical and accessibility considerations must be addressed proactively to ensure the responsible and equitable integration of AI in education. The future of English composition likely lies in a collaborative partnership between human teachers and AI assistants, leveraging the strengths of both to create a more effective and engaging learning experience for all.

The ongoing development of AI will undoubtedly continue to shape the landscape of English language learning and composition. As AI systems become increasingly sophisticated, their ability to understand and respond to the nuances of human language will only improve. This suggests a future where AI plays a central role in personalized learning, providing customized support and feedback to each student, fostering a more effective and efficient learning process for all.
